Health Monitoring in the Grand Est Region. Update as of December 20, 2023.
Key points
Bronchiolitis
OSCOUR®: In S50-2023, the proportion of emergency department visits related to bronchiolitis among children under 2 years of age decreased slightly. It stood at 23.3%, representing 501 visits. The proportion of hospitalizations for bronchiolitis among all hospitalizations following an emergency department visit for children under 2 years of age was 40%.
SOS Médecins: In S50-2023, the proportion of SOS Médecins’ activity related to bronchiolitis continues to decline. It stands at 8.2%, or 47 consultations.
Influenza
Entering the epidemic phase.
OSCOUR®: The number of emergency department visits for flu-like illness, all ages, continues to rise in week 50-2023 compared to the previous week (216 visits versus 166 in week 49-2023), representing 0.8% of activity.
SOS Médecins: The number of consultations for flu-like symptoms, across all age groups, has risen sharply in week 50-2023 (890 consultations compared to 654 in week 49-2023); the share of activity for flu is 10.9%.
COVID-19
OSCOUR®: In Week 50-2023, the number of emergency department visits for COVID-19 continued to rise compared to previous weeks (577 visits compared to 530 in Week 49-2023), representing 2.2% of total activity.
SOS Médecins: In Week 50 of 2023, the number of SOS Médecins consultations for COVID-19 remained stable compared to the previous week (299 consultations versus 316 in Week 49 of 2023), representing 3.7% of the activity of SOS Médecins associations in the region.
Acute Gastroenteritis
OSCOUR®: The number of emergency department visits for gastroenteritis, across all age groups, remained stable in Week 50 of 2023 compared to previous weeks. The share of activity is 1% and is higher than that observed during the same period last year.
SOS Médecins: The number of consultations for gastroenteritis across all age groups continues to rise in Week 50 of 2023. The share of activity for these conditions is 6% and is higher than that observed during the same period last year.
